gamepimp:
--- Quote from: Howard_Casto on June 30, 2020, 02:07:35 am ---I've got one more question.... will the dongles just work with the included Saturn controller or can you use the other standard stuff? (ps3, switch ,ect.) I'm just asking because opts streams makes me think it might be cool to use an arcade stick for some of these games.... I could just buy a ps4 stick or something. --- End quote --- If you buy the setup like I have (bluetooth controller and dongle) you apparently can connect other controllers like XBOX One, PS4, and Switch. It doesn't look like the 2.4GHz dongle will work with other controllers though unfortunately. You would also lose out on the USB option for PC, but the bluetooth stuff is available now on Amazon. Supposedly 2.4GHz can have less latency than bluetooth, but I don't seem to notice any lag with my setup right now. |
